Some LED lights have a strobe effect due to a phenomenon called 'flicker,' often caused by fluctuations in the power supply or the dimming technologies used. LEDs operate by rapidly turning on and off; when this operation syncs improperly with the power frequency or if the LED's driver (an internal component that regulates power) is of low quality, a visible strobe or flicker effect occurs. To minimize this effect, choose high-quality LED lights with a high flicker index rating or invest in LEDs that utilize constant current drivers, enhancing the stability of the light output.
FAQs & Answers
- What causes flickering or strobe effects in LED lights? Flickering or strobe effects in LED lights are commonly caused by power supply fluctuations, poor-quality LED drivers, or incompatible dimming technologies.
- How can I reduce flicker in LED lighting? To reduce flicker, select high-quality LED lights with a low flicker index and LED drivers designed for constant current output to ensure stable light.
- Are all LED lights prone to the strobe effect? Not all LED lights exhibit a strobe effect; it typically occurs in LEDs with low-quality drivers or when synchronized improperly with power frequency.
